The purpose of grinding and regrinding is to reduce the ore to a size small enough to liberate and recover the valuable minerals.
Iron ore is a rock or mineral from which metallic iron can be extracted economically. It constitutes 5% of the earth’s crust. Viable forms of ore contain between 25% and 60% iron. Ore greater than 60% iron is known as natural ore or direct shipping ore, meaning it can be fed directly into iron-making blast furnaces.

The iron ore lump obtained from ROM crushing and screening plants will continue to break down into − 6.3 mm particles during material handling from the product screen to stockpiles, port, and customer.Drop test conditioning of diamond drill core and crusher lump samples has been developed to simulate material handling and plant stockpiling (Clout et al., 2007).
PRIMARY CRUSHER SELECTION CRITERIA • Will it produce the desired product size at required capacity • Will it accept the largest feed size expected • What is the capacity to handle peak loads • Will it choke or plug • Is the crusher suited to the type of crushing plant design • Is the crusher suited for underground or in-pit duty

Iron ore is the key raw material for steel production enterprises. Generally, iron ore with a grade of less than 50% needs to be processed before smelting and utilization. After crushing, grinding, magnetic separation, flotation, and gravity separation, etc., iron is gradually selected from the natural iron ore.
